A Lifelong Lie: Woman Discovers Her “Adoptive” Mother Is Actually Her Aunt

A 25-year-old woman’s quest to uncover her roots led to a revelation that redefined her entire life. Sophie had always been told she was adopted by a woman named Margaret, who raised her in a cold and distant manner, constantly reminding Sophie to be “grateful” for being saved from an orphanage. This story, however, was a complete fabrication.

Prompted by her best friend, Sophie visited the Crestwood Orphanage, only to be told they had no record of her ever being there. Confronting Margaret, she learned the shocking truth: Margaret was actually her biological aunt. Sophie’s mother, Elise, was Margaret’s sister, who had chosen to forgo cancer treatment to carry her pregnancy to term, dying shortly after giving birth. She had entrusted her newborn daughter to Margaret.

Margaret confessed that she had never wanted children and resented the responsibility. She invented the adoption story to create emotional distance from the child she blamed for her sister’s death. The lie allowed her to raise Sophie without forming a maternal bond, leading to years of emotional neglect. The revelation was devastating for Sophie but also opened a path toward understanding and a fragile, new beginning in her relationship with the aunt who raised her.
